Applications
Santolina triene (CAS 2153-66-4) is an unsaturated terpene hydrocarbon found in Santolina essential oils and other Asteraceae, used mainly in R&D: as a GC/GC-MS reference standard for qualitative/quantitative profiling and quality control of essential oils, botanical authentication, and chemotaxonomy; as an aroma component for sensory mapping and a fragrance modulator in experimental perfumery with herbal-woody-terpenic nuances; as a synthetic building block and precursor in catalytic transformations to access bicyclic/terpenoid scaffolds; as a model substrate to study autoxidation, photochemistry, and formulation stability; and as a target in in vitro bioactivity screening (e.g., antimicrobial or insect-repellent potential) and ecological semiochemical studies, while large-scale commercial uses remain limited; it is typically handled under inert atmosphere, protected from light and oxygen to minimize oxidative degradation.

| Name | CAS | Botanical | Proportion |
|---|---|---|---|
| Chamomile, wild (Morocco) | Ormenis mixta, fam. Asteraceae (Compositae) | 0.4% | |
| Artemisia vestita (India) | Artemisia vestita Wall. ex Dc., fam. Asteraceae (Compositae) | 0.36% | |
| Annual wormwood, leaf (U.S.A., Indiana) 1 | 84775-74-6 | Artemisia annua L., fam. Asteraceae (Compositae) | 0.2% |
| Annual wormwood, leaf (U.S.A., Indiana) 2 | 84775-74-6 | Artemisia annua L., fam. Asteraceae (Compositae) | 0.04% |
| Annual wormwood, flower (U.S.A., Indiana) | 84775-74-6 | Artemisia annua L., fam. Asteraceae (Compositae) | 0.16% |
| Santolina chamaecyparisus (Egypt) | 84961-58-0 | Santolina chamaecyparisus L., fam. Asteraceae (Compositae) | 1.4% |
| Annual wormwood (Yugoslavia) | 84775-74-6 | Artemisia annua L., fam. Asteraceae (Compositae) | 0.03% |
| Santolina insularis (Italy) 1a CO2-extract | Santolina insularis L., fam. Asteraceae (Compositae) | 0.7% | |
| Santolina insularis (Italy) 1b hydrodistilled | Santolina insularis L., fam. Asteraceae (Compositae) | 1.8% | |
| Achillea filipendulina (Iran) flower | Achillea filipendulina Lam., fam. Asteraceae (Compositae) | 2.1% | |
| Annual wormwood (India) 2 | 84775-74-6 | Artemisia annua L., fam. Asteraceae (Compositae) | 0.5% |
| Espeletia weddellii leaf | Espeletia weddellii Sch. Bip. ex Wedd., fam. Asteraceae (Compositae) | 1.5% | |
| Argyranthemum adauctum ssp. adauctum | Argyranthemum adauctum ssp.adauctum Humphries, fam.Asteraceae (Compositae) | 2.9% | |
| Argyranthemum adauctum ssp. gracile | Argyranthemum adauctum ssp.gracile Humphries, fam. Asteraceae (Compositae) | 19.8% |
